Default Transfer Case Leak 2004 RX 330

After 2 attempts to fix leak by Toyota dealer replaced pinion seal twice, leak still persists. Was advised, today, by dealer that he thinks leak is caused by clogged vent which would require 15 hours labor removing transfer case to get at the vent. He thought vent being clogged might cause high pressure causing leak through seal.

Very disappointed that this may be the cause with vehicle having only 69,000 miles on speedo. Anyone else had this problem?
